Institute of Public Enterprise (IPE) has been engaging in educational practices since its establishment in 1964. The institute offers nine different postgraduate courses after the completion of a bachelor’s degree. The admission in IPE is performed on the basis of scores obtained by the candidates in diverse aptitude tests or entrance exams accepted by the IPE Hyderabad. Thus, a student willing to enroll in different courses in the institution must be aware of a few important factors to consider while taking admission in IPE, which is to be discussed in detail in the article.

The important factors to consider while taking admission in IPE, primarily include the information of the admission process of IPE, which consists of a series of steps initiated by taking a common eligible entrance test by prospective candidates after the completion of their bachelor’s degree from a recognizable institute or university across India. After taking the entrance exam, the student is required to fill the admission form, available on the official website of the IPE.

The selection process depends on the cumulative standard, consisting of past academic records, scores from entrance exams, scores obtained in group discussion, and personal interview rounds.   • Accreditations: One of the key factors that help in deciding on a college is accreditations, and accreditations of IPE surely aids in the admission process. IPE is considered one of the top B-schools that enable students to explore new dimensions of learning. The IPE is accredited by AICTE and SAQS

  • Scholarships: IPE offers lucrative scholarships to the students who have excelled in the various entrance exams accepted by the institute. The meritorious students are not only facilitated with the honor of receiving scholarships but also receive sufficient monetary rewards as a form of financial aid for the students.

Affirmative Scholarship Scheme

A scholarship of INR 60,000 is awarded to the top-ranked among the Scheduled Caste (SC), Scheduled Tribe (ST), and Muslim minority candidates in the eligible entrance exams accepted by IPE.

  • Courses Offered & Fees at IPE: IPE Hyderabad offers six courses at the postgraduate level, that aim to deliver an all-comprehensive learning experience and holistic development to the students. Apart from the diversity in the courses offered at the PGDM level, the fee structure of the offered courses also ranges from 3.80 lakh to 8.0 lakh for 2 years of the program, which is a cost-effective fees structure for numerous students in India.

  • Placements and Collaborations: IPE Placements is one of the trendiest topics to be discussed about the institution. The institute runs a well-organized and resourceful placement program that provides students with a great opportunity to venture into the corporate world. In the year 2020 itself, the institute offered placement to 95% of students with the highest package attained at INR 20,84,000 per annum. Hey there!

Yes, for AP EAMCET (EAPCET) 2025, your Intermediate public exam marks are added to your entrance exam score. Specifically, 25% weightage is given to IPE marks in group subjects (physics, chemistry, mathematics/Biology) and 75% is given to your AP EAMCET score. T his combined score determines your final rank for admissions.

For example, if you scored 97.5% in IPE, then 25% of that (i.e., 24.375 marks) would be added t0 your EAMCET score ( out of 75) to get a composite score out of 100. Therefore, performing well in both in IPE and AP EAMCET is crucial for securing a good rank. All the best!

Admission Streams at SASTRA University

SASTRA University offers B.Tech admissions through two streams:

  • Stream 1 (70% of seats) : Admissions are based on a combined score, with 75% weightage to Class 12 (IPE) marks and 25% to JEE Main scores .

  • Stream 2 (30% of seats) : Admissions are based solely on normalized Class 12 marks .
